One computer.

It has multiple fiber-optic transport cards that handle keyboard/video/mouse.
The fiber is run to every room.

At the fiber jack in the room, you plug in a KVM dongle.

You can then set up TV's or monitors where ever you want and do full, shared computing.

Use wireless keyboard/mouse to get to the KVM dongle on the wall jack.

Each user is allocated his own processor QoS so that one person can't hog all of the resources.
